Over 14,000 decisions for seasonal workers – our seasonal work bulletin is no longer updated regularly for the time being

Publication date 9.9.2021 15.50
Press release

This year, the Finnish Immigration Service has issued 12,795 certificates for seasonal work by 6 September 2021. The total number of decisions concerning certificates for seasonal work is 13,077. In total, 1,413 seasonal workers have received a residence permit for seasonal work, and the total number of decisions is 1,502.

The peak season for seasonal work is now over. That is why our seasonal work bulletin is no longer updated every week for the time being.

Follow the processing of your application easily online 

You can easily follow the processing of your application online:

  • When you apply for a residence permit for seasonal work in Enter Finland, you can follow the processing of your application in the online service.
  • If you have applied for a residence permit for seasonal work, you can ask about the status of your application from our chatbot Kamu on our website migri.fi. Kamu will check the status of your application among all other applications with the same type of matter and processing grounds. For more information, see the page migri.fi/chat1.

We can only inform the applicant of the decision. If you are an employer of a seasonal worker, you should ask you employee to inform you of the decision.

We decide applications related to seasonal work in the order they have been submitted. However, we take into account the starting date of the employment, if the application is submitted well in advance of that date. We attempt to process applications submitted for the same employer at the same time.
